Cyanotype, an analogue photographic print process that uses light-sensitive chemicals to create Prussian blueprints of objects and/or images. Experimenting with the concept of photographs acting as memory traces, the project aims to document the objects that have now become essentials of our altered lifestyle. These blueprints now become a photographic trace of the current trying times.
